God, Save Us From Your Followers
This was not a t-shirt but a bumper sticker I saw a few years ago. At first glance, it was offensive. Does this person despise Christians so much that they want nothing to do with us? But after thinking about it, I began to realize it was an indictment on modern-day, western culture Christianity. We’re not like Jesus like we want to be. We’re unauthentic, unloving, uneducated, wannabes.
Okay, that’s a little harsh. I’m not saying that all Christians are like that. Maybe its just me. But it can seem that way. I have a friend who is a hard core atheist. She’s an awesome person who is funny, entertaining, and one of the best people to hang out with, but she voices her opinions boldly. One day I was talking to her and she shared with me that in her experience, Christians were the most unloving of anyone she had ever met. I asked what she meant and she explained it this way. You see, when a Christian comes around her, they like to share about Jesus and talk to her about changing her life around. And she’ll put up with it for awhile. But as soon as she lets them know how stupid she believes God is and how she’ll never turn to that belief system, she tells me that her Christian “friends” go away. She said they can handle loving me up until the point that I disagree with their opinion. She finds this ironic since she has friends that differ with her on politics, morality, and even other religions. But no Christian friends. Not one.
When are we going to take seriously the idea of loving someone unconditionally? My friend nailed it. Christians today are so consumer-driven that we don’t want to love someone who is different (the way Christ loves us). We just want to be right. And hang out with other people who also believe we’re right. And live a nice life with a nice car and a nice house in a nice church surrounded by nice people who can all love us too. Suffer for our faith? We’ll do that once a year on a mission trip. After all, loving people you don’t have to hang around the rest of your life is easy. But spending time with a cursing, atheist, pro-choice, democrat and love her unconditionally? Most of us just do not want to try.
